In Letters to a Young Contrarian, bestselling author Christopher Hitchens delivers a compelling guide to the importance of principled dissent and the value of disagreement. Aimed at inspiring future radicals and rebels, Hitchens draws from influential figures like Emile Zola and Rosa Parks while urging the next generation to embrace contrary positions. With his signature polemic style, he contrasts stagnant ideologies, underscoring that disagreement is vital for personal integrity and societal progress.
